Healthy Minds App may not have tons of bells and whistles or celebrities reading you bedtime stories, but what it does feature is: actual meditation practices backed by actual science.
It was created by Healthy Minds Innovations, the non-profit organization founded by world-renowned neuroscientist Dr. Richard Davidson. A pioneer in the study of meditation and well-being since the 1970s, Dr. Davidson’s work was famously encouraged by his friend and confidant, the Dalai Lama, who challenged him to apply the rigor of modern science to positive qualities like kindness and compassion. This app is the direct result of that challenge and is built on decades of research from the Center for Healthy Minds at the University of Wisconsin–Madison.
It’s available for iOS and Android and is 100% free. Not a freemium model, free trial or limited use model, a testament to the intention behind the app - to help teach people the skill of wellbeing, nothing more, nothing less.
